ESL teacher in Japan reports: "After class, some girls came up and asked, 'Can we play Mario?' I explained that I didn't have my DS with me, but one girl pointed to the case and its DS logo. I opened the case and watched their faces fall as they saw the PSP. One 11-year-old boy actually cried. Cried. You can't buy brand loyalty like that."
